The Diabetes Injection Pens market is a rapidly growing segment within the healthcare industry. Diabetes, a chronic condition characterized by high blood sugar levels, affects millions of individuals worldwide. The prevalence of diabetes has been steadily increasing, driving the demand for effective and convenient treatment options. Diabetes injection pens have emerged as a popular choice for delivering insulin, a hormone essential for managing blood sugar levels.
Diabetes injection pens are medical devices designed to administer insulin in a precise and controlled manner. They consist of a cartridge or reservoir containing insulin, a dial or button for dosage selection, and a needle for subcutaneous injection. These pens offer an alternative to traditional insulin vials and syringes, providing greater convenience, accuracy, and ease of use for patients.

Key Market Insights
-
Rising Adoption of Smart Pens: Smart insulin pens with digital dose tracking and connectivity are forecast to grow at a double-digit CAGR, driven by demand for data-driven diabetes management.
-
Prefilled vs. Reusable Dynamics: Prefilled pens retain the largest share due to ease of use, but reusable pens are gaining traction for sustainability and cost-effectiveness.
-
GLP-1 Segment Expansion: GLP-1 receptor agonist pens, such as liraglutide and dulaglutide devices, are experiencing rapid uptake owing to benefits in weight management and cardiovascular risk reduction.
-
Emerging Market Growth: APAC and Latin America are high-growth regions, propelled by rising healthcare spending, expanding diabetes programs, and local manufacturing of biosimilar pen devices.
-
Patient Preference Trends: Surveys indicate over 70% of pen users prefer pen devices over vials/syringes for comfort, portability, and dosing simplicity.

Category-wise Insights
-
Prefilled Insulin Pens: Dominate market for ease of use and consistent dosing; popular among newly diagnosed and elderly patients.
-
Reusable Pens: Preferred in regions emphasizing sustainability and lower long-term cost; require separate cartridge purchases.
-
Smart Pens: Integrate with apps and CGM data; favored by tech-savvy patients and managed-care programs aiming for tight glycemic control.
-
GLP-1 Agonist Pens: Growing share due to dual benefits of glycemic control and weight loss; often prescribed in Type 2 diabetes.
-
Biosimilar Pens: Offer cost savings; adoption depends on physician acceptance and local regulatory approvals.

Covid-19 Impact
The pandemic accelerated remote care models and home-delivery of diabetes supplies, favoring user-friendly pen devices over clinic-administered injections. Interruptions in supply chains prompted manufacturers to diversify distribution channels and reinforce inventory management. Increased virtualization of diabetes-education programs emphasized pen technique training via telehealth. Although clinic closures temporarily slowed new pen initiations, pent-up demand for diabetes management tools drove a rebound in 2021โ22, with smart pen adoption particularly surging among digitally engaged patients.
